Searched refs:pfb (Results 1 - 17 of 17) sorted by relevance

/external/mesa3d/src/gallium/drivers/freedreno/
H A Dfreedreno_draw.c63 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
108 resource_written(batch, pfb->zsbuf->texture);
114 resource_written(batch, pfb->zsbuf->texture);
121 for (i = 0; i < pfb->nr_cbufs; i++) {
124 if (!pfb->cbufs[i])
127 surf = pfb->cbufs[i]->texture;
190 pfb->width, pfb->height, batch->num_draws,
191 util_format_short_name(pipe_surface_format(pfb->cbufs[0])),
192 util_format_short_name(pipe_surface_format(pfb
212 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
285 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
[all...]
H A Dfreedreno_gmem.c112 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
127 struct fd_resource *rsc = fd_resource(pfb->zsbuf->texture);
132 for (i = 0; i < pfb->nr_cbufs; i++) {
133 if (pfb->cbufs[i])
134 cbuf_cpp[i] = util_format_get_blocksize(pfb->cbufs[i]->format);
149 width = pfb->width;
150 height = pfb->height;
172 for (i = 0; i < pfb->nr_cbufs; i++)
384 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
402 batch, pfb
[all...]
H A Dfreedreno_batch_cache.c368 const struct pipe_framebuffer_state *pfb)
370 unsigned idx = 0, n = pfb->nr_cbufs + (pfb->zsbuf ? 1 : 0);
373 key->width = pfb->width;
374 key->height = pfb->height;
375 key->layers = pfb->layers;
376 key->samples = pfb->samples;
379 if (pfb->zsbuf)
380 key_surf(key, idx++, 0, pfb->zsbuf);
382 for (unsigned i = 0; i < pfb
367 fd_batch_from_fb(struct fd_batch_cache *cache, struct fd_context *ctx, const struct pipe_framebuffer_state *pfb) argument
[all...]
H A Dfreedreno_batch_cache.h73 struct fd_context *ctx, const struct pipe_framebuffer_state *pfb);
H A Dfreedreno_util.h168 fd_half_precision(struct pipe_framebuffer_state *pfb) argument
172 for (i = 0; i < pfb->nr_cbufs; i++)
173 if (!fd_surface_half_precision(pfb->cbufs[i]))
/external/mesa3d/src/gallium/drivers/freedreno/a4xx/
H A Dfd4_gmem.c138 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
141 if ((pfb->width > 4096) && (pfb->height > 4096))
193 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
236 OUT_RING(ring, A4XX_GRAS_CL_VPORT_XOFFSET_0((float)pfb->width/2.0));
237 OUT_RING(ring, A4XX_GRAS_CL_VPORT_XSCALE_0((float)pfb->width/2.0));
238 OUT_RING(ring, A4XX_GRAS_CL_VPORT_YOFFSET_0((float)pfb->height/2.0));
239 OUT_RING(ring, A4XX_GRAS_CL_VPORT_YSCALE_0(-(float)pfb->height/2.0));
260 OUT_RING(ring, A4XX_GRAS_SC_WINDOW_SCISSOR_BR_X(pfb->width - 1) |
261 A4XX_GRAS_SC_WINDOW_SCISSOR_BR_Y(pfb
331 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
525 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
600 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
665 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
711 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
761 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
[all...]
H A Dfd4_emit.c512 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
516 mrt_comp[i] = ((i < pfb->nr_cbufs) && pfb->cbufs[i]) ? 0xf : 0;
532 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
535 if (util_format_is_pure_integer(pipe_surface_format(pfb->cbufs[0])))
676 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
677 unsigned n = pfb->nr_cbufs;
679 if (pfb->zsbuf)
681 fd4_program_emit(ring, emit, n, pfb->cbufs);
/external/mesa3d/src/gallium/drivers/freedreno/a2xx/
H A Dfd2_gmem.c103 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
140 OUT_RING(ring, xy2d(pfb->width, pfb->height)); /* PA_SC_WINDOW_SCISSOR_BR */
164 emit_gmem2mem_surf(batch, tile->bin_w * tile->bin_h, pfb->zsbuf);
167 emit_gmem2mem_surf(batch, 0, pfb->cbufs[0]);
226 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
237 x0 = ((float)tile->xoff) / ((float)pfb->width);
238 x1 = ((float)tile->xoff + bin_w) / ((float)pfb->width);
239 y0 = ((float)tile->yoff) / ((float)pfb->height);
240 y1 = ((float)tile->yoff + bin_h) / ((float)pfb
337 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
360 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
382 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
[all...]
/external/mesa3d/src/gallium/drivers/freedreno/a5xx/
H A Dfd5_gmem.c325 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
331 emit_mrt(ring, pfb->nr_cbufs, pfb->cbufs, NULL);
332 // emit_zs(ring, pfb->zsbuf, NULL);
341 for (i = 0; i < pfb->nr_cbufs; i++) {
342 if (!pfb->cbufs[i])
347 pfb->cbufs[i], BLIT_MRT0 + i);
352 struct fd_resource *rsc = fd_resource(pfb->zsbuf->texture);
363 fd5_pipe2color(fd_gmem_restore_format(pfb->zsbuf->format));
373 emit_mem2gmem_surf(batch, ctx->gmem.zsbuf_base[0], pfb
384 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
458 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
501 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
[all...]
H A Dfd5_draw.c189 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
202 for (int i = 0; i < pfb->nr_cbufs; i++) {
205 if (!pfb->cbufs[i])
211 enum pipe_format pfmt = pfb->cbufs[i]->format;
267 if (pfb->zsbuf && (buffers & (PIPE_CLEAR_DEPTH | PIPE_CLEAR_STENCIL))) {
269 util_pack_z_stencil(pfb->zsbuf->format, depth, stencil);
H A Dfd5_emit.c411 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
415 mrt_comp[i] = ((i < pfb->nr_cbufs) && pfb->cbufs[i]) ? 0xf : 0;
431 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
434 if (util_format_is_pure_integer(pipe_surface_format(pfb->cbufs[0])))
538 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
540 unsigned nr = pfb->nr_cbufs;
/external/mesa3d/src/gallium/drivers/freedreno/a3xx/
H A Dfd3_gmem.c354 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
396 OUT_RING(ring, A3XX_GRAS_CL_VPORT_XOFFSET((float)pfb->width/2.0 - 0.5));
397 OUT_RING(ring, A3XX_GRAS_CL_VPORT_XSCALE((float)pfb->width/2.0));
398 OUT_RING(ring, A3XX_GRAS_CL_VPORT_YOFFSET((float)pfb->height/2.0 - 0.5));
399 OUT_RING(ring, A3XX_GRAS_CL_VPORT_YSCALE(-(float)pfb->height/2.0));
428 OUT_RING(ring, A3XX_GRAS_SC_WINDOW_SCISSOR_BR_X(pfb->width - 1) |
429 A3XX_GRAS_SC_WINDOW_SCISSOR_BR_Y(pfb->height - 1));
441 struct fd_resource *rsc = fd_resource(pfb->zsbuf->texture);
444 ctx->gmem.zsbuf_base[0], pfb->zsbuf);
447 ctx->gmem.zsbuf_base[1], pfb
536 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
723 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
797 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
924 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
964 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
980 struct pipe_framebuffer_state *pfb = &batch->framebuffer; local
[all...]
H A Dfd3_emit.c702 struct pipe_framebuffer_state *pfb = &ctx->batch->framebuffer; local
703 int nr_cbufs = pfb->nr_cbufs;
707 fd3_program_emit(ring, emit, nr_cbufs, pfb->cbufs);
/external/mesa3d/src/gallium/drivers/etnaviv/
H A Detnaviv_context.c109 struct pipe_framebuffer_state *pfb = &ctx->framebuffer_s; local
149 resource_written(ctx, pfb->zsbuf->texture);
152 resource_written(ctx, pfb->zsbuf->texture);
154 for (i = 0; i < pfb->nr_cbufs; i++) {
157 if (!pfb->cbufs[i])
160 surf = pfb->cbufs[i]->texture;
/external/icu/android_icu4j/src/main/tests/android/icu/dev/test/serializable/
H A DFormatHandler.java2214 PluralFormat pfb = (PluralFormat)b;
2218 String textb = pfb.format(i);
/external/icu/icu4j/main/tests/core/src/com/ibm/icu/dev/test/serializable/
H A DFormatHandler.java2213 PluralFormat pfb = (PluralFormat)b;
2217 String textb = pfb.format(i);
/external/clang/test/SemaCXX/
H A Dconstant-expression-cxx11.cpp1065 constexpr const int *(Base::*pfb)() const =
1067 static_assert((pb9->*pfb)() == &a[9].n, "");

Completed in 349 milliseconds